Comprehending Off-Plan Projects


Off-plan projects refer to properties that are offered prior to they are finished. Stakeholders purchase these properties based on architectural plans, visualizations, and promises of future outcomes. The attraction of off-plan investments lies in the prospect for appreciation in real estate value as construction progresses and the need for residential or commercial spaces increases, particularly in booming markets like the United Arab Emirates.


In the UAE, off-plan developments have gained popularity due to the country’s rapid city growth and economic growth. Buyers often find that purchasing off-plan offers reduced entry prices and customizable payment plans, allowing for significant savings compared to purchasing completed properties. Developers typically encourage buyers with favorable payment schedules and incentives like price reductions, which can make investing in off-plan developments a more enticing option.


However, investing in off-plan properties carries inherent hazards. Benefits of Investing Off-Plan in the UAE


Investing in pre-construction properties in the UAE offers a distinct opportunity for buyers seeking to step into the real estate market at a favorable price point. Developers often offer these properties at a reduced rate than completed projects, allowing investors to secure potentially significant capital appreciation before the project being built. This cost advantage can result in higher returns once the property is completed and the market value rises.


An additional significant benefit of investing off-plan is the flexible payment plans that developers typically provide. Many projects provide investors with structured payment schedules that enable buyers to make payments in installments throughout the building phase. This flexibility not only eases the financial burden but also allows investors to manage their resources more efficiently without the need for a large upfront payment.


Moreover, investing off-plan in the UAE provides buyers with a broader selection of properties and locations. Many new developments are situated in prime areas that might not be available for investment in completed properties. This accessibility to desirable locations enables investors to choose projects that align with their personal goals and preferences, whether for rental income or future resale opportunities.


Important Factors for Investing in Off-Plan Properties


Investing in off-plan real estate in the UAE presents unique opportunities, but it also comes with certain risks. One key consideration to think about is the developer’s reputation and track record. Investigating past projects, looking into delivery timelines, and reviewing feedback from prior buyers can offer insight into whether a developer is trustworthy. A reputable developer with a history of successful projects is likely to offer greater assurance for your investment.


A further significant aspect is the financial arrangement and financial structure of the purchase of the off-plan property. Buyers should thoroughly understand the payment schedule, including any down payment needs and subsequent installments. Additionally, it’s crucial to be aware of potential adjustments to payment plans and how they may impact your budget. Planning for unforeseen costs, such as maintenance fees or additional taxes on the property, is also crucial to ensure a successful investment experience.


Lastly, consider the location and future potential of the area where the property is situated. Emerging neighborhoods may offer excellent long-term value as infrastructure improves and interest grows. Assessing nearby facilities, transportation links, and future developments in the area can help you predict the property’s future value growth. Understanding these market dynamics is key to making informed decisions in off-plan investing.
